The Landscape of Indonesian Television
Before we jump into the specific shows, it's super important to get a feel for what makes Indonesian television tick. For a while now, top TV Indonesia has been dominated by a few key genres that really resonate with the audience. We're talking about sinetron, which are basically Indonesian soap operas, and these have been a staple for decades. They often feature intense romantic storylines, family conflicts, and dramatic twists that keep viewers tuning in night after night. But it's not just about the drama, guys! The comedy scene is also thriving, with variety shows and sitcoms that showcase the unique humor and cultural nuances of Indonesia. Think witty dialogues, slapstick comedy, and relatable everyday situations that will have you rolling on the floor laughing. And let's not forget the reality TV shows, which have gained immense popularity, offering glimpses into the lives of celebrities, aspiring talents, and even ordinary people facing extraordinary challenges. These shows tap into our fascination with human stories and the desire to see dreams come true, or sometimes, see them spectacularly fall apart β all in good fun, of course!
Furthermore, the rise of digital streaming platforms has also influenced what we consider top TV Indonesia. While traditional broadcast channels still hold a strong presence, many Indonesian viewers are now also turning to platforms like Netflix, Vidio, and GoPlay for their entertainment fix. This has led to a broader range of content, including more sophisticated dramas, web series with higher production values, and even documentaries that tackle important social issues. The competition has definitely heated up, pushing local production houses to up their game and create content that can stand shoulder-to-shoulder with international offerings. Streaming Stars: The New Wave of Indonesian Content
Guys, the game has totally changed with the rise of streaming! While traditional top TV Indonesia still has its charm, web series and exclusive content on platforms like Vidio, Netflix, and WeTV are becoming seriously popular. These shows often offer more mature themes, edgier storylines, and higher production values, appealing to a younger, more digitally-savvy audience. Think critically acclaimed series like "Layangan Putus" (The Broken Marriage), which became a massive cultural phenomenon, sparking widespread discussion about relationships and infidelity. Its raw, emotional storytelling and strong performances captivated audiences, proving that Indonesian content could compete on a global scale. This success paved the way for more high-quality web series exploring diverse genres, from romantic comedies and thrillers to historical dramas and social commentaries.
These streaming platforms are investing heavily in local productions, collaborating with talented directors, writers, and actors to create content that is both authentic and internationally appealing. You'll find series that tackle social issues with nuance, explore complex character arcs, and push creative boundaries. The freedom from traditional broadcast censorship often allows for more daring and experimental storytelling. Staying Connected: Where to Find the Top Shows
So, how do you actually catch all these amazing top TV Indonesia shows? For the traditional broadcast channels like RCTI, SCTV, ANTV, and Indosiar, you can simply tune in with a regular TV antenna or subscribe to a cable TV package. Many of these channels also have their own apps or websites where you can catch up on missed episodes, though sometimes with a delay or requiring a subscription. For the digital natives and those craving more exclusive content, platforms like Vidio are a goldmine. They host a vast library of local content, including popular web series and live sports. Netflix, of course, has a growing selection of Indonesian films and series, often co-produced or exclusively licensed. Other platforms like GoPlay and WeTV also offer a curated selection of Indonesian dramas and web series.
